Mastering the Flare Knife in Freedom Wars Remastered

Freedom Wars Remastered presents players with formidable challenges, particularly the massive Abductors. This guide focuses on acquiring and effectively utilizing the Flare Knife, a valuable tool in overcoming these towering foes.

Obtaining the Flare Knife

The Flare Knife is surprisingly accessible early in the game. Once you achieve Level 003 Code Clearance, visit Zakka in The Warren. This vendor sells a range of items, including the Flare Knife, for 3,000 Entitlement Points. Equip it via the Loadout menu in the Personal Responsibility Portal, selecting an available Combat Item slot.

Utilizing the Flare Knife

The Flare Knife is a single-use combat item specifically designed for severing Abductor limbs. This is crucial for players who prefer Polearms or Heavy Melee weapons, providing a way to sever limbs without relying on Light Melee options.

To use it, lock onto a severable Abductor part and use your Thorn to grapple onto it. With the Flare Knife equipped, a severing option will appear, initiating a quick-time event (QTE). Successfully completing the QTE by rapidly pressing the designated button severs the limb. Be aware that the Abductor may attempt to disrupt the process by leaping or crashing.

Cooperative play enhances the Flare Knife's effectiveness. Teaming up allows for repeated snares, significantly increasing the chances of a successful sever. Remember to repurchase the Flare Knife before each subsequent Operation, as it's a single-use item.
